The Dogtooth tuna is a robust, predatory fish known for its elongated body and sharp, conical teeth. It inhabits tropical and subtropical reefs and open waters. Reaching up to 96 inches and 280 pounds, it preys on smaller fish and squid. This powerful swimmer is solitary or forms small schools, showcasing agile hunting behavior. This summary is AI generated
